We can quickly create a new query that imports the xml file into excel. Is there a way how to save this query directly to the xml file on disk. Apr 16, 2019 download the version of the power query addin that matches the architecture x86 or x64 of your office installation. It takes an xquery expression as a string literal, an optional context item, and other bind variables and returns the result of evaluating the xquery expression using these input values.
To run a query, click the html, excel, or xml link to the right of the query on the search results page. The schema xml for each xml must be created by hand and deployed with the driver. Is a string, an xquery expression, that queries for xml nodes, such as elements and attributes, in an xml instance. The following xml file is used in various examples in the linq to xml documentation. I have an xml file downloaded from my ftp location to a local folder and data in this. How to export data from database tables to an xml file using. How to export xml from sql server using ssis zappysys blog. You can also add the caching on the xml file so that when the contents of the file changes than the users will get the new content instead of the old. Xmlquery lets you query xml data in sql statements. Importing and processing data from xml files into sql server tables. Download, screenshots and instructions are on the firstobject xml editor page. Sql joins with multiple xml files customer support. Importing and processing data from xml files into sql server.
The cdata odbc driver for xml uses the standard odbc interface to link xml data with applications like microsoft access and excel. Create new xml documents, parse and modify existing xml documents from the. There is also a firefox extension, xquseme, and a special build of firefox, xdib xquery in a browser, for unning clientside xquery scripts. Provide a link to external sql scenario instead of immediate query provision. Bulk importing xml data from a file that contains a dtd. Another xml query specific feature is support for xml files, for fetching. But up to some level we can run our application with xml as a database for its simplicity. Linq to xml is like the document object model dom in that it brings the xml document into memory. The book has a nice and nonacademic approach to learning xml and using the xml query language xquery to build application software.
Click on the xpath builder button to use the xml browser to navigate the xml structure and select an element from the xml data. Click this link on the query manager or query viewer search results page. This option is available after you have click the html link. Writexml, it is hard to force it to write exactly as you want. Follow the steps below to use microsoft query to import xml data into a spreadsheet and provide values to a parameterized query from cells in a spreadsheet. How to automate saving database query results to xml file. Few options available in export file task which are not found in xml generator transform such as compression, splitting options, simple export without layout. Setting expandedresults to true will also return the article title. Shows how to use the let clause to calculate intermediate values in a linq to xml query. Whether you want to output the query results in sql to xml or attempt to export the data in a sql server database to the xml file, you can find the way to make it here. Crossref query results can be retrieved in several formats. I am using your firstobject xml editor to read in an xml file and parse through the. If your database allows returning of xml field, generate it in the database during fetch operation for sql server it maybe be as simple as calling for xml raw at the end of the query. This allows the reading of the xml file or source without processing.
In this tip we look at how you can parse an xml file and load into. Download the version of the power query addin that matches the architecture x86 or x64 of your office installation. The xmlelements to tables mapping enables you to do all the cool querying stuff with your xml files, that i have shown you so many times before. This post seems to illustrate the above case the best only difference is that a xls is used in stead of a xml.
Download microsoft power query for excel from official. There is save result as in context menu, but with 98900 rows i run out of my 8gb memory with this option. It seems like it would make sense to write some kind of script to go through the table and query the xml data one row at a time, then save the text as a. Lets assume your entire xml file looks like this for a clear.
And in order to allow anyone to easily try this example, there is no authentication step. Sql to xml how to export data from sql server to xml. Output we have seen all the necessary operations that are needed to create and maintain an xml file database. Allows querying of xml to retrieve data from a node or node set. To modify the file type option settings for microsoft excel worksheets when using microsoft windows 2000. In this example we will use a simple xml file containing mock contact information with names, emails, cities and countries. After you click the html link, you have an option to view the xmlp formatted result in a new browser by clicking the download to xml file link on the html result page. Saxon xslt and xquery processor sourceforge is the home for opensource versions of the saxon xslt 3. If you click this option, the file download page appears, at which point you can open the xml formatted query result in your browser or save it to your local machine. Download the compressed, production jquery migrate 3. Net technology is widely supported xml file format. This example shows use of expandedresultstrue along with enablemultiplehitstrue. A nested select command with for xml clause is used to represent the hierarchy of tables as xml. When you have need to generate xml from multiple sql query tables and save into xml file or ssis variable then you can consider export xml file task.
Super small library to retrieve values and attributes from the xml ast generated by xmlreader pladariaxml query. The select xml cmdlet lets you use xpath queries to search for text in xml strings and documents. With the for xml clause, you can return the result of a query to xml. I cant figure out how to query over the xml sequentially, though. It is also used to add custom opening and closing xml tags. You can create a schema file using any text or xml editor. It is an external file with statement clauses, parameters or whole sql script. You can now perform your data manipulation here but we will keep the data as is. In this program it search the node and its child nodes and extract the data in child nodes. It provides a new object model that is lighter weight and easier to.
Also, there are optional steps to tune the reporting process. I see the xml in a result window, but i cannot save it. I am trying to query an xml document and have the following query. After you click the xml link, query result is downloaded to browser with the xml output formatted for use with bi publisher and there are options that enable you to open, save, or cancel the downloaded file. Specify a code page in the codepage option of the query that. We can read an xml file in several ways depends on our requirement. See enabling the query access list cache, cachebasedir xml. Xquery is a language for finding and extracting elements and attributes from xml documents. Download the uncompressed, development jquery migrate 1. Create table xmldocs id int identity not null primary key, xmldoc xml not null go. Xml populated menu are great when you know that the menu contents will not change frequently. My goal is to pull down copies of each xml entry into a separate file in order to flatten the data in postprocessing. The book starts with data concepts and then gives indepth explanations of the tools, apis, and libraries available to work with the data.
Specifies an xquery against an instance of the xml data type. I use microsoft sql server management studio to execute this result. Net framework provides the classes for read, write, and other operations in xml formatted files. Here we are using xmldatadocument class to read the xml file. You can query and modify the document, and after you modify it you can save it to a file or serialize it and send it over the internet. The selectxml cmdlet lets you use xpath queries to search for text in xml.
For our purposes, ive created a local copy of books. Enter an xpath query, and use the content, path, or xml parameter to specify the xml to be searched. Import data from xml using power query free microsoft. With sql server management studio, you can save your sql database as csv and then you can convert the database files to xml, pdf or other formats as you like. How can i download a batch of xml files from a sql server. Download the uncompressed, development jquery migrate 3. We have seen all the necessary operations that are needed to create and maintain an xml file database. The second version helps you update code to run on jquery 3. In the following example, suppose you have a number of xml files stored in the directory. These examples show bulk import of xml documents into a sql server. You can include your join statement in the where clause, like so.1356 390 857 1573 1609 1165 1451 1262 750 651 1321 1152 640 721 1618 1298 1268 277 638 1164 96 1243 57 714 619 519 1168 697 891 528 285